    For anyone wondering about spine injury here is the answer
    Yes it can cause some spine injuries IF you're not specially trained for this sport. If an average not trained person will try going all out in this mas wrestling competition, he will most likely get spine pains if he will even manage to hold his opponent.
    People are specially trained for this sport. First of all, new mas wrestlers are building their spine strength for months or even for years. They don't go all out when they just start mas wrestling, they start slowly while building spine strength and making it more durable. Of course you also need proper technique to not get spine injuries. In your first months coach will teach you for basics and various techniques but he must not let you to compete or going all out in this sport unless you're ready for it.
